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| chainfruit | Madagascar widow's-thrill |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Plantae (Plants) | Plantae (Plants) |
| Phylum same | Magnoliophyta (Flowering Plants) | Magnoliophyta (Flowering Plants) |
| Class same | Magnoliopsida (Dicots) | Magnoliopsida (Dicots) |
| Order | Gentianales (Gentianales) | Saxifragales (Saxifragales) |
| Family | Apocynaceae | Crassulaceae |
| Genus | Alyxia | Kalanchoe |
| Species | Alyxia ilicifolia | Kalanchoe blossfeldiana |
Evolutionary Relationship
chainfruit and Madagascar widow's-thrill share a common ancestor at the Class level: Magnoliopsida. (Dicots)
